Bug#31160: MAKETIME() crashes server when returning NULL in ORDER BY using filesort

Even though it returns NULL, the MAKETIME function did not have this property set,
causing a failed assertion (designed to catch exactly this).
Fixed by setting the nullability property of MAKETIME().
